Levels of Service
LOS is reported on a scale of “A” through “F”. The general definition
of each LOS is as follows:
LOS “A” – This is a very high service level in which the roadway
and associated features are in excellent condition. All systems
are operational and users experience no delays.
LOS “B” – This is a high maintenance service level in which the
roadway and associated features are in good condition. All systems
are operational. Users may experience occasional delays.
LOS “C” – This is a medium maintenance service level in which
the roadway and associated features are in fair condition. Systems
may
occasionally be inoperable and not available to users. Short term
delays may be experienced when repairs are being made, but would
not
be excessive.
LOS “D” – This is a low maintenance service level in which the
roadway and associated features are kept in generally poor condition.
Systems failures occur because it is impossible to react in a timely
manner to all problems. Occasionally delays may be significant.
LOS “F” – This is a very low service level in which the roadway
and associated features are kept in poor and failing condition.
A backlog of systems failures would occur because it is impossible
to react in a timely manner to all problems. Significant delays
occur on a regular basis.
